资源简介:
地震灾害遥感监测案例数据集包含2008-2023年国内多场典型地震灾害遥感影像数据,以及灾区损毁建筑物、居民地、道路、桥梁等承灾体损毁程度等信息。
数据集中包括可见光、微波雷达等多模态遥感影像,以及地震烈度数据、数字地形模型等数据源。基于地理学、灾害学知识、结合专家解译经验提取承灾体,及其损毁程度信息,并构建深度学习样本数据集,迭代训练、不断优化深度学习模型。在地震灾害应急监测中,对灾前、灾后遥感影像开展变化检测,快速识别,并提取承灾体位置、范围以及损毁程度信息。该数据集为地震应急遥感监测提供了信息支持,为地震灾害评估提供有效的数据模板。为地震灾害的应急响应和灾后重建提供科学依据和技术支撑。
The Case Dataset for Remote Sensing Monitoring of Earthquake Disasters contains remote sensing image data of multiple typical earthquake disasters in China from 2008 to 2023, as well as information on the damage degrees of hazard-affected bodies such as damaged buildings, residential areas, roads, and bridges in the disaster-stricken areas.
The dataset includes multi-modal remote sensing images such as visible light and microwave radar, as well as data sources like earthquake intensity data and digital terrain models (DTMs). Based on the knowledge of geography and disaster science and expert interpretation experience, hazard-affected bodies and their damage degree information are extracted, and a deep learning sample dataset is constructed for iterative training and continuous optimization of deep learning models. In emergency monitoring of earthquake disasters, change detection is conducted on pre- and post-disaster remote sensing images to quickly identify and extract the location, scope, and damage degree information of hazard-affected bodies. This dataset provides information support for emergency remote sensing monitoring of earthquakes, offers effective data templates for earthquake disaster assessment, and supplies scientific basis and technical support for earthquake emergency response and post-disaster reconstruction.
